What is a Service BDC Manager?

A Service BDC (Business Development Center) Manager oversees the team responsible for managing customer communications and appointments for a dealership's service department. They handle inbound and outbound calls, schedule service appointments, follow up on missed opportunities, and ensure a high level of customer satisfaction. The Service BDC Manager also trains and motivates staff, sets performance goals, and uses data to improve processes. Their role is vital in maximizing service department efficiency and increasing customer retention.

How to become a Service Bdc Manager?

To become a Service Bdc Manager, candidates typically need experience in automotive service departments, strong customer service skills, and knowledge of dealership operations. A high school diploma or equivalent is usually required, and some employers prefer candidates with prior experience in sales or service coordination. Developing skills in communication, organization, and familiarity with dealership management software can also be beneficial.

How does a Service BDC Manager typically collaborate with service advisors and technicians to improve customer satisfaction?

A Service BDC (Business Development Center) Manager plays a crucial liaison role between the customer-facing BDC team, service advisors, and technicians. They ensure that appointments are scheduled efficiently, customer concerns are clearly communicated, and follow-ups are handled promptly. By regularly meeting with service advisors and technicians, the manager helps address workflow bottlenecks, shares customer feedback, and implements process improvements to enhance the overall service experience. This collaborative approach not only streamlines operations but also directly contributes to higher customer satisfaction and retention.

What is the difference between Service Bdc Manager vs Service Advisor?

AspectService Bdc ManagerService Advisor
CredentialsTypically requires dealership experience, customer service skills, and sometimes certifications in automotive service managementRequires automotive knowledge, customer service skills, and often ASE certifications
Work EnvironmentOffice-based role managing customer communications and dealership operationsFrontline role interacting directly with customers and technicians
Employer & Industry UsageUsed mainly in automotive dealerships to oversee service department operationsCommonly found in automotive service departments as the primary customer liaison

The Service Bdc Manager focuses on managing customer communications and dealership operations, while the Service Advisor directly interacts with customers to recommend and explain vehicle repairs. Both roles require automotive knowledge and customer service skills, but their responsibilities and work environments differ significantly.
